A prominent sales solutions provider in Mississauga is looking for a Talent Acquisition Specialist to manage the full recruitment cycle for field and corporate teams. You will collaborate with HR and hiring managers to identify recruitment needs and execute sourcing strategies. Candidates should have 18 to 24 months of recruitment experience and knowledge of the sales industry. This role offers a flexible full-time schedule with a dynamic work environment.

The Talent Acquisition Specialist is responsible for managing the full recruitment cycle to attract qualified and diverse talent for both field store teams and corporate teams. You will regularly collaborate with HR, program managers, and recruiting leaders to identify current and future hiring needs. Expertise in sourcing, a passion for high-volume recruiting, providing an exceptional candidate experience, and promoting the client's and company’s activities and brand are essential for success in this role.
